> What happens if something in the middle breaks and you don't have a buffer? What happens if there is no iron shortage but the steel furnace blows up? Aren't buffers important in such situations? Okay, lets have two factories that convert 5-iron into 1-steel (Factorio ratio): * "Buffer Factory": requiring 7000 steel to buffer up / 35000 iron before working at full capacity. * "JIT Factory" : requires 200 steel to bu…

Your initial example is not making an argument against buffers in the supply chain, but against large production runs requiring large inputs. In the context of logistics, I think of a buffer as a system that slowly fills up due to excess capacity greater than demand, which can be drawn down in times when demand exceeds production. You seem to be referring to a buffer as a process which requires large inputs to get st…

> You seem to be referring to a buffer as a process which requires large inputs to get start producing.

No.

> I think of a buffer as a system that slowly fills up due to excess capacity greater than demand, which can be drawn down in times when demand exceeds production.

Yes. That's what I mean.

The steel furnaces __use iron__. This means that during the buffering process, the steel furnaces are "saving up iron", and preventing the rest of your factory from using iron.

That is to say: the 35,000 iron you put into the steel furnace __COULD HAVE BEEN USED__ in the yellow-belt portion of your factory, and could have instead made 23333 yellow belts.

--------

Its not worthwhile to save up 7000 steel (aka: 35,000 effective iron) when that iron could have been used to make _OTHER_ parts of your factory do important things.

-----

It doesn't matter if you "buffer up" that 35,000 iron slowly, quickly, all at once or over anything. Any such buffering means your "steel portion" has arbitrarily decided that the iron should be saved here, in a box unused. While shortages propagate outward to all the other parts of your Factorio where you __COULD__ have been using the iron instead.

> Just in time doesn't mean "buffer free". It means eliminating unnecessary buffers. this is sort of tautological, or at least hinges on how you interpret "necessary". certainly no one would implement a buffer knowing at the time that it was unnecessary! but even in factorio, it can be worth maintaining a buffer deeper than what's needed to keep the factory running at 100% under optimal conditions. you don't want to…

> you don't want to find out that you're out of stone when your bots stop autoreplacing your walls and the biters flood in

But stone is used in more than just walls. You also use stone to make concrete.

So what do you buffer? Do you buffer stone? Cause buffering stone didn't actually solve anything (your "stone reserves" are the mine itself. If you really wanted to see "how good" your reserves are, you check how many stone mines you have left).

Do you buffer concrete? No. That wastes stone unnecessarily. Maybe you need the stone for the biter attack.

Do you buffer walls? No. That wastes stone. Maybe you need the stone to make concrete.

--------

So here's our 4 potential buffers:

* Buffer Stone -- Inferior to just running by your stone mines every few minutes and checking to see how many stone is left in the mine. The __MINES__ itself are your buffer.

* Buffer Concrete -- Wastes walls.

* Buffer Walls -- Wastes concrete.

* Buffer Concrete AND Walls -- Wastes furnaces, pumpjacks, and oil refineries. All of which require stone to make (and can't be made out of Concrete or Walls).
